Frequently Asked Questions About HR Software
What's the difference between HRIS, ATS, and Performance Management software?
An HRIS (Human Resource Information System) is a core platform for managing employee data, payroll, and benefits. An ATS (Applicant Tracking System) focuses specifically on the recruitment process. Performance Management software helps track goals, conduct reviews, and manage feedback. Often, these functionalities can be found integrated within a single HRIS or as standalone systems.
How do I choose the right HR software for my small business?
For small businesses, prioritize ease of use, essential features (like payroll and basic record-keeping), scalability, and budget. Look for solutions designed for smaller teams that offer good customer support. Start with your most critical needs and choose software that can grow with you.
What should I consider regarding data security and privacy?
Data security is paramount. Look for vendors with robust security measures, including data encryption, regular backups, secure access controls, and compliance with data privacy regulations like GDPR or CCPA. Ask potential vendors about their security protocols and certifications.
Can different HR software systems integrate with each other?
Yes, many modern HR software solutions offer integrations with other systems (e.g., payroll, accounting, ATS). Check the integration capabilities of any software you're considering to ensure it works seamlessly with your existing tech stack. APIs (Application Programming Interfaces) are key for smooth integrations.
How much does HR software typically cost?
Costs vary widely based on the type of software, features included, number of employees, and vendor pricing models (e.g., per employee per month, subscription tiers). Basic HRIS might start from a few dollars per employee per month, while comprehensive suites can be significantly more. Always request detailed pricing and check for implementation or hidden fees.
